I HAVE a 2000 Jackaroo turbo diesel which since new has been very sluggish when first starting. If left to warm up it will blow out smoke when driving off. It has been serviced by my Holden dealer since new and they say it is unburned fuel. What would cause unburned fuel to come out as smoke? I also have a 2004 diesel Prado that does not need warming up.
IT'S not normal. I would go to your nearest diesel-engine specialist and have them check the injectors for leakage. If the injectors are leaking you might be getting a fuel accumulation, which would make it harder to start. Once started the excess fuel would burn off and be seen as smoke.
